We are just days away from the start of London TV Screenings and BBC Studios Showcase, as the global TV community descends upon the UK capital to strike deals on the latest content hitting the market.

This year’s event is taking place against the background of some serious upheaval in the TV world, as companies of all sizes cut jobs and content requirements to fit new levels of spending as they try to balance budgets.

So ahead of the screenings, TBI took the pulse of more than 25 distribution companies to find out how they are finding their footing on this shifting ground and what the next 12 months have in store. Below is just a sample of their insights, with more to come over the course of next week.
